$300 too much for a used 9" 3.50 Posi?
I found a used (but "in excellent condition") 9" center section with 3.50 gears and 31-spline limited slip posi on craigslist a few hours from my house. I don't have to pay shipping. He says the posi looks new and gears are in great shape. Is it worth it?
Going in a 55 Chevy Sedan with BBC and Muncie (unless I get a great deal on something like a T56). I'm going to be getting a housing built from Currie, Moser or Strange. Larry |

I blew up a Trac-Loc in my pickup and grabbed a new used center section for $150 IIRC, so $250 isn't outrageous but seems a little steep to me. Whether it's worth it or not is up to you. Tobin |
Check you local pull a part salvage yard. They are 85 bucks each here.(Washington) That is a complete housing, center section, axles and backing plates. Brakes are an extra 35 bucks.
